We are seeking a dedicated Junior IT Support Officer to join our team. Your primary focus will be on providing initial technical support and assistance to end users, troubleshooting and resolving common IT issues, and ensuring smooth operations of IT systems. You will deliver excellent customer service, efficiently handle user inquiries, and contribute to incident management and knowledge base development.
The Role
- Configure and deploy Windows 11 computers using established deployment processes.
- Provide first-level IT support via phone, email, and ticketing systems, resolving common hardware and software issues.
- Perform basic troubleshooting of desktop, laptop, printer, and mobile device issues and escalate more complex incidents as required.
- Install, configure, and maintain Windows 11 and Microsoft 365 applications. Monitor environments and escalate issues as needed.
- Manage users and user access in Active Directory and other systems. Follow IT service management best practices.
- Maintain accurate documentation and contribute to IT policy and procedure development.
- Track and document IT hardware and software assets. Support inventory control.
- Escalate unresolved issues to senior IT staff or vendors. Liaise with manufacturers for specialized hardware support.
- Participate in shift rotations and complete Service Desk tickets promptly. Perform other duties as needed.
About You
To be successful in the role you will possess the following:
- TAFE Diploma of Information Technology or Higher Education.
- 1 – 2 years’ experience in an IT Support Desk role.
- Experience with Microsoft Server or Windows 10/11 MCSA, Network Cisco CCNA, Microsoft 365 Fundamentals.
- Experience deploying and configuring Windows 10/11 workstations.
- Basic understanding of Microsoft Active Directory and Microsoft 365 environments.
-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ills for common desktop and application issues.
- Excellent communication and customer service skills.
- Ability to follow documented procedures with a high level of accuracy and attention to detail.
- Exposure to networking concepts and Windows Server environments is desirable but not essential.
- Microsoft 365 Fundamentals, ITIL Foundation, or related certifications would be advantageous.
Due to the Security Clearance required for this position, applicants must be an Australian Citizen and eligible to obtain and uphold a NV1 Security Clearance through the Australian Department of Defence.
